Are Contemporary Science Books Better Than Classics?

Both contemporary science books and classic works have their unique value and contribute to our understanding of the natural world. However, the question of which is better can be boiled down to the context and purpose of the reader.

Understanding the Transition from Classics to Contemporaries

In my personal experience, comparing a 1960s astronomy textbook with modern resources reveals a fascinating glimpse into scientific progress. The older books are often filled with outdated theories and concepts that, while once groundbreaking, are now outdated. For example, reading about the solar system as it was understood in the mid-20th century can be a humorous exercise, but it also serves as a reminder of how much we have learned in the ensuing decades.

Additionally, it is important to recognize that scientific progress often occurs in leaps rather than gradual and steady advancements. This can lead to a significant discrepancy between what was taught in the past and what current understanding entails. Practically, this means that some concepts considered gospel a few decades ago might now be considered just one of many theories in the broader scientific community.

Why Are Classic Works Still Relevant?

Despite the rapid advancements in science, classic works such as Maxwell's original papers and Newton's Principia Mathematica remain highly relevant. These texts not only provide foundational knowledge but also give readers a deeper appreciation for the intellectual struggle and mathematical foundations that underpin modern scientific understanding.

If you closely examine these historical documents, you will notice that the mathematical language used was far more cumbersome than what we have today. This historical insight can help us understand the evolution of scientific thought and the challenges faced by early scientists. For instance, the notation and formalism used in Maxwell's equations can appear convoluted, highlighting the vast improvements in mathematical rigor and clarity that have occurred over time.

Progressive Value of Contemporary Science Books

Contemporary science books, on the other hand, often incorporate decades of research and advancements. They are designed to be more user-friendly and accessible, providing contemporary readers with a comprehensive understanding of the latest scientific findings. These books are not only written with the latest technologies and methodologies in mind but also reflect ongoing research and exploration.

The risk associated with older books is that they may not only contain outdated information but also could have deeply flawed or disproven theories. While much of the knowledge presented in classic texts is still highly relevant, there is a significant risk of focusing on outdated and potentially harmful ideas. Therefore, contemporary science books are essential for staying up-to-date with the latest developments and avoiding the pitfalls of relying solely on historical accounts.
